What is Revisional Bariatric Surgery?

Occasionally, patients may experience inadequate weight loss after their initial weight loss surgery. To give patients an additional option for weight loss, surgeons can perform this procedure to rectify or modify the previous surgery to improve weight loss outcomes or address complications such as band slippage or pouch dilation.

How is it performed?

  • The specific procedure will depend on the individual’s circumstances.
  • The procedure may involve converting to a different type of weight loss surgery, revising a previous surgery, or repairing a complication.
